continuation:

14:46:30 – Technical screen / stream offline (broadcast ended).
18:14:30 – Stream back online.

18:20 – An adult stork departs the nest.

18:24 – Male arrives at the nest, bringing moss/grass as nesting material.
18:25 – Male departs.

18:28 – Male returns to the nest and provides water (hydration) to the chicks.
18:29 – Male departs.

18:36 – Female arrives at the nest; both parents are simultaneously present.
18:44 – Feeding: Chicks are fed with large fish.
18:58 – Female departs.

21:07 – Female arrives at the nest.
21:09 – Feeding: Female delivers food to the chicks.
21:12 – Female departs.

Key Takeaways:

Technical Disruption: The stream was offline for nearly three and a half hours (from 14:46:30 until 18:14:30).

Hydration and Material: Shortly after the broadcast resumed, the male showed active care by bringing grass to line the nest, followed by a quick return to deliver water to the chicks.

Parental Overlap: Both parents met at the nest at 18:36, leading to an abundant feeding session with large fish. The female returned for another short visit after 21:00 to deliver a late feeding.
